Quick Verdict

Mem AI (4.2 rating) and Krisp (4.5 rating) are both freemium AI tools serving distinct purposes. Mem AI focuses on intelligent note organization and knowledge management, using AI to automatically tag, link, and surface information with minimal manual effort. Krisp specializes in real-time AI noise cancellation for communication, removing background sounds from calls and recordings across any application. While both offer free plans, Mem AI targets productivity and information workers who need connected note-taking, whereas Krisp serves professionals requiring clear audio in remote meetings. Their core AI applications differ fundamentally—one organizes text knowledge, the other processes audio signals—making direct feature comparisons less relevant than use case alignment.

Features

Mem AI features AI-powered search, automatic note linking, tagging, and knowledge surfacing, focusing on reducing manual organization effort. Krisp features bidirectional noise cancellation, echo removal, and real-time audio processing using machine learning algorithms. Their feature sets don't overlap—one processes text and relationships, the other processes audio signals. Mem AI enables knowledge discovery; Krisp enables clear communication.

Integrations

Krisp integrates universally with any communication application (Zoom, Teams, Slack, etc.) and microphone at the system level, requiring no per-app configuration. Mem AI integrates with popular productivity and collaboration tools, though specific integrations aren't detailed. Krisp's system-level approach provides broader compatibility, while Mem AI's integrations likely focus on data import/export and workflow connections.

User Experience

Both tools emphasize simplicity: Mem AI offers a clean interface with AI handling organization automatically, though some users desire more manual control. Krisp provides one-click activation with minimal performance impact, though occasional over-processing may slightly distort voice. Mem AI users rate it 4.2/5, Krisp users 4.5/5, suggesting slightly higher satisfaction with Krisp's execution.
